While investigating the leaked-file-descriptor issue in the Burrowtrace plugin host, we found that several external plugins fail silently because their credentials for the internal descriptor-audit service expired last quarter. Plugin authors should update their manifests to request the new scope before retesting. For interim validation against the staging auditor, authenticate using the key below.

gateway credential: kto3_qfe

# Broker Upgrade Approvals

Quick heads-up for support: the Quillpipe message broker upgrade (v6 to v7) needs sign-off before any maintenance window gets booked. Don't promise customers a date until approval lands. Rollback plan is on the Ops page, and the queue drain takes about 20 minutes. If tickets come in about delayed messages, point folks there. The approver for this upgrade is listed below.

account owner for bawip-tahag: Raleth Quenok

## 2.8 — New waveform preview defaults

Heads-up for anyone new to Chordlet: waveform previews now render at a lower sample density by default, which made the editor way snappier on long podcast files. Zoomed-in views still fetch full resolution on demand, so nothing looks worse. If a client complains, check overrides first. The new defaults are:

service settings:
[casax]
port = 6379
team = rusir
host = casax.zemvarhq.corp
region = outer-4
access_code = ac_9808ce
timeout_ms = 1500